When you start looking at new floors, the final bill depends on a few specific things. The biggest factor is the type of material you pick—hardwood, tile, or luxury vinyl all have different price points. You also have to think about the size of the area, how much prep work the subfloor needs, and whether you are removing old flooring first. Complex patterns or tight corners can add labor hours, which shifts the total. We can help you break down the numbers, with exact pricing confirmed free on the call.

The '1-3 rule' commonly refers to leaving an expansion gap, about 1/3 inch, around the perimeter of floating floors. This allows the material to expand and contract with changes in humidity and temperature, which is important in Fort Wayne's climate. Pros ensure proper installation.
In Fort Wayne, vinyl plank (LVP) is often favored for its superior water resistance, making it ideal for kitchens, bathrooms, and basements. Laminate can be a more budget-friendly option but is more sensitive to moisture. Call to get advice tailored to your home's specific conditions.
